Location
On the northern end of Miami Beach lies the “village” of Bal Harbour. On this stretch of the island, the atmosphere is serene and you can spend hours peacefully gazing at the gorgeous aqua blue water of the Atlantic Ocean. Bal Harbour is not only known for its beaches, but also for the exclusive and high-end boutiques of the Bal Harbour Shops. The St. Regis is an oceanfront property that is conveniently located across the street from this shopping center, and minutes away from the popular tourist destination South Beach.

Oceanfront Pools
The resort offers two infinity pools: the main ocean pool, and on a separate level the adult-only pool with a hot tub.
For extra comfort, guests may rent Oceanfront Day Villas and Oasis Cabanas. The Day Villas are placed below the Tranquility pool. They are air-conditioned cabanas that come complete with a wet bar, bath and shower, flat screen TV, and full Butler service. The open-air Oasis Cabanas can be found near the main pool and Remède Spa, and include amenities such as fresh fruit, bottled water, and soft drinks throughout the day.
The Deluxe Oceanfront Suite
All the rooms and suites at The St. Regis Bal Harbour have been carefully designed so that each one features a spacious balcony with unobstructed views of the Atlantic Ocean. Led by our butler, George, and a gentleman named Bob, we took a private elevator up to our Deluxe Oceanfront Suite on the 12th floor. We immediately fell in love with our “new home.” At 1250 sq ft, the elegantly appointed suite has a six-guest dining area, a kitchenette with top-of-the-line appliances, a master suite, a separate living area that doubles as a second bedroom with its own full bathroom, and two furnished balconies.
Two tablets, one in the living room and one by the bed, are used to control the lighting, temperature, drapes, and to request housekeeping service.
The luxurious en-suite bathroom has a deep soaking tub, rain shower head, separate toilet area, double sink vanity, and bath products from The St. Regis’ Remède Spa. In addition, an LCD TV is embedded behind a glass mirror, and it is one of four televisions that are ready to entertain us during our stay. A second full bathroom can be found off of the suite’s living area (it comes with a shower, but no tub).
St. Regis Butler Service
One of the advantages of being guests in a suite is having access to special services provided by The St. Regis Butler. For a stress-free vacation, you can have the Butler unpack and pack your luggage, press your clothes, and deliver coffee or tea to your room. Dining
The St. Regis Bal Harbour Resort presents various dining experiences. At J&G Grill by Chef Jean-Georges Vongerichten, guests can savor fine, world-class cuisine while sitting by floor-to-ceiling windows to take in the ocean views. Breakfast is served at Atlántico, and poolside and beach dining is provided by Fresco Beach Bar & Grill.
If you are craving for Japanese food, The St. Regis Bar and Sushi Lounge serves up Sushi, Sashimi and Nigiri from 4:00 PM to 11:00 PM. And let’s not forget the Traditional Afternoon Tea Service that The St. Regis is famously known for.
Guests should also check out the all glass temperature-controlled Wine Vault, as it holds an impressive collection of the world’s finest wines and rare vintages. Stop by the bar at 7:30 PM for a nightly champagne sabering ceremony, and stay for the live music afterwards.
Spa, Fitness Center, and Shopping
Although Johnny and I are typically the type of people who love to venture out, all the amenities available at The St. Regis made us reluctant to step away from the property.
For the ultimate indulgence, head over to Remède Spa, where you can unwind and experience customized services. Couples may want to try the 5-hour long Bal Harbour Restorative Gold Package, which includes a signature body wrap, the Bal Harbour 24-Karat Designer Facial, and anti-aging manicure and pedicure. In addition, you may choose where to receive the spa treatment, be it in your room or on a secluded spot on the beach.
The St. Regis makes it fun for guests to stay fit and healthy during vacation. The St. Regis Athletic Club faces the pool and the ocean, and is equipped with state-of-the-art machines. Many of the cardio machines have built-in TVs with Internet access. Group classes, individual training sessions, and a comprehensive wellness program are also offered by the club.
A boutique store and the Rosenbaum Contemporary art gallery can be found next to the lobby. For guests’ convenience, the St. Regis and Neiman Marcus have a partnership program called the Neiman Marcus Closet. Prior to arrival, fill out a short survey of your fashion preferences, then Neiman Marcus’ shopping team will fill your suite’s closet with a personalized wardrobe collection. Keep what you like, and return other items using The St. Regis Butler service.
